Phi Delta focuses on charity
DELPHOS — Phi Delta Sorority is a group of women in Delphos who meet in one another’s homes on a regular basis from September through May to incorporate well-being and charity throughout the community.
The sorority was formed in 1933 by three women who missed their college sorority friendship; Ila Scott Doepker, Loretta Kerman Smith and Margaret Roberts Hargrove.
By January 1934, the three had recruited other community women to form an organization revolving around charity, friendship and tolerance.
In a Delphos Herald article on Feb. 3, 1934, it was announced: “At a recent meeting held at the home of Mrs. Ted Stallkamp, the Phi Delta Sorority was organized for the purpose of local charity. The following girls are the charter members of the group; Margaret Roberts, Madeline Humphreys, Hortense Metcalfe, Betty Scherger, Martha Stallkamp, Effie Marie Knowlton, Florence Humphreys, Ila Scott, Ladonna Lockhart, Mrs. Ted Stallkamp, Mrs. John Marsh, Sara Veil and Loretta Kerman.”
In November 1934, the sorority decided to focus on a Christmas charity project to purchase shoes for the needy children in Delphos and this tradition continues today. The women donate shoes and boots to children between the ages of 5-12, averaging 130 pairs annually. They also purchase some first-aid items for the nurse’s station in both local schools.
Fundraisers over the years have ranged from dances, style shows, raffles, craft and bake sales and plant sales. In recent years, sorority members have raised monies by Christmas poinsetta sales, chicken BBQ dinners on the Fourth of July and the Skyline Chili Supper.
